  8. Nutter McClennen & Fish -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Nutter_McClennen_&_Fish

    Nutter McClennen & Fish LLP is a long-standing law firm in Boston, Massachusetts. The firm has a wide variety of practice areas including intellectual property, technology, business, and real estate law. Nutter was co-founded by Samuel D. Warren II and Louis Brandeis. Brandeis practiced at the firm until his appointment to the Supreme Court.

  9. Robert F. Carrozza -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Robert_F._Carrozza

    Robert Carrozza was born January 9, 1940, in Winthrop, Massachusetts, to Mario Carrozza and Marie Mosca. After Robert’s mother died in 1944, his father remarried Angelina Abbatessa Russo, who had also been previously married. Angelina was the mother of Patriarca crime family capo Joseph (JR) Russo born May 5, 1931, in East Boston, Massachusetts.
